使用单个循环,很容易编写{% if not loop.last %}JOIN{% endif %}来从循环的最后一次迭代中删除JOIN。使用嵌套循环,我们可以,允许我们检查是否处于两个循环的最终迭代中。尽管如此,我还是有一个3级嵌套的解决方案,这个解决方案非常冗长:......
{% if not loo
我正在学习一个官方的Python教程,但我无论如何也搞不懂示例中嵌套的for循环是如何工作的: for x in range(2, n):循环:for x in range(2, n):应该会在每次迭代中生成(x, n-1),从而生成以下几对x, n:(2, 1), (3, 2), (4, 3), (5, 4), (6, 5), (7,显然,这永远不会产生n % x == 0,但这是我唯一能想到<e
我写了一个应该重复1000次的方法,但这个方法又是另一个循环(像嵌套循环).Since运行时间不合理,我决定写一个线程来更快地运行它。myMethod = new NewClass();
thread.start();问题是,当我运行它时,线程跳过主类中的第一次迭代(当为i=0时),然后在下一次迭代中,它跳过</e
有没有办法跳过这个for循环中的第一次迭代,这样我就可以将for循环放在for循环中,以便将列表中的第一个元素与其他元素进行比较。STARTING AT 2) if count > count2 : CONDITION
语法是如何实现的呢我只需要做一个5深度的For循环。因此,下一个将从3开始,然后从4开始,